4.0
Based on 2 reviews

Ilford Town House- Close To London Ilford Train Station

Ilford Town House- Close To London Ilford Train includes a terrace and is located around 20 minutes' walk from the edwardian South Park.

Wanstead Flats is about 2 miles away, while St Luke's Church is within easy reach of the homestay. The apartment is approximately 15 minutes' drive from the international ExCeL London Convention Centre and London City airport is 15 minutes’ drive away.

At Ilford Town House- Close To London Ilford Train, a separate toilet and a shower have been provided to enhance your comfort. Bath sheets and towels can also be found.

The accommodation is equipped with self-catering amenities such as an electric kettle, coffee and tea making facilities, and a kitchenware, providing guests with the opportunity to prepare their own meals.

Book Town House- Close To London Ilford Train Station Ilford

General information

Contact information

33 Mortlake Road, Ilford, United Kingdom;

Town House- Close To London Ilford Train Station reservations available at 'rooms'

Town House- Close To London Ilford Train Station phone number isn't available on our site, if you want to call Town House- Close To London Ilford Train Station visit site of a hotel

Town House- Close To London Ilford Train Station Location

 33 Mortlake Road, Ilford, United Kingdom

Town House- Close To London Ilford Train Station Homestay Deals

4.0 logo

Review score

Based on 2 reviews

logo

Write a quick review

Your rating

(/10)
Please enter your name
Please enter a valid email address

Main Features

No pets allowed

Town House- Close To London Ilford Train Station Amenities

  • General

    No smoking on site
  • No pets allowed
  • Dining

    Electric kettle
  • Cookware/ Kitchen utensils
  • Room Amenities

    Tea and coffee facilities
  • Dining table

Town House- Close To London Ilford Train Station Offers

Rooms